Are you tired of arguments that end in frustration, hurt, or disconnection? Ever wonder if “winning” an argument is really a victory—or if it leaves you and your relationships worse off? In this eye-opening episode of “Strong Mind, Strong Body,” licensed therapist & wellness expert Angie Miller reveals the surprising truth about arguments and why nobody ever truly “wins.” Drawing on years of therapy experience and powerful lessons from Acceptance & Commitment Therapy, Angie explores: ·      Why “winning” an argument can actually damage your relationships ·      The hidden costs of being “right”—including lost trust, safety, and connection ·      How defensiveness and contempt slowly erode connection ·      The crucial difference between understanding and dominating in a disagreement ·      The key role of psychological safety in all your conversations ·      Actionable “homework” to transform your next conflict from competition to meaningful connection Whether it’s with your spouse, kids, coworkers, or friends—this episode gives you the mindset shift and tools you need to move from argument to understanding.
